メインコンテンツへスキップ
メインコンテンツへスキップ

ローカルファイル Dictionary ソース

ローカルファイルソースは、ローカルファイルシステム上のファイルから Dictionary データを読み込みます。これは、TSV、CSV などの形式、またはその他のサポートされている形式でフラットファイルとして保存できる、小規模で静的なルックアップテーブルに適しています。

設定例:

SOURCE(FILE(path './user_files/os.tsv' format 'TabSeparated'))

設定項目:

Setting説明
pathファイルへの絶対パス。
formatファイル形式。Formats で説明されているすべての形式がサポートされます。

ソースに FILE を指定した Dictionary を DDL コマンド(CREATE DICTIONARY ...)で作成する場合、ClickHouse ノード上の任意のファイルへ DB ユーザーがアクセスすることを防ぐため、ソースファイルは user_files ディレクトリ内に配置する必要があります。

参照